THE STANDARD AND FORM OF TOURIST REGIONS IN BRAZIL: THEORETICAL-METHODOLOGICAL PROPOSAL FOR THE REGIONALIZATION OF TOURISM.
Tourism Regionalization Program; Tourist Regions; Territorialization; Planning.
This qualification report aims to present the thesis proposal under development with the PPGE/UFRN. The study contemplates a discussion on the tourist regionalization proposed by the Ministry of Tourism, through the Tourism Regionalization Program, noting the fragility of this process, since the criteria adopted for its definition do not satisfactorily contemplate the geographic principles necessary to regionalize. The conceptual failure and the criteria in the constitution of the Brazilian tourist regionalization causes a mismatch of the norm (regional limits and non-articulated municipalities) with the form-content of the tourist activity. From the identified problem, the objective of the research is to develop a methodology of regionalization from the functional cohesion manifested by the tourist activity. The methodological proposal under construction includes, among other elements, the survey of fixed and tourist flows, seeking to identify the functional coherence in the constitution of tourist regions. The preliminary test of the methodology was carried out in the state of Rio Grande do Norte, showing the inconsistencies of the official regionalization. Subsequently, the state of Pernambuco will be considered in order to deepen the proposed methodology.
